[Taybin Rutkin]
>Please make MOMENTARY imply TOGGLED.  This lets older hosts degrade
>gracefully.

a recommendation, yes i think that would be very sensible indeed.
please consider that implying TOGGLED makes MOMENTARY a '1 or 0'
valued control for all time, which is an unnecessary limitation.

[Taybin Rutkin]
>The presence of both MOMENTARY and TRIGGER seems redundent.  TRIGGER
>means that it's reset to 0 after one call to run() or run_adding()?
>That'll happen so fast, the user won't even notice the UI change.
>If TRIGGER is for scale values, how will it scale if it's set to 0
>after every call?  The distinction between them is overlapping and
>confusing.

TRIGGER is meant to accommodate MIDI and other mechanical trigger
sources, it's not exclusively tailored for display user interface
elements. there are a number of convenient ways to represent it
on-screen though, like the good old peak meter.

in fact there already are plugins implementing the TRIGGER behaviour.
it needs official status.
